Biography

Eric describes the birth of his professional career as "a choice he made in May of 1993." The choice he refers to was whether to pursue his interests in the legal profession or the unstable world of entertainment.

Mr. Martsolf graduated from Dickinson College in Carlisle Pennsylvania with a BA in Political Science with honors, emphasizing in mass media politics and constitutional law. His time away form his studies was spent performing in unlimited capacities-choirs, operas, musicals, barbershop quartets, and even a rock band which was proclaimed Harrisburg's best new band. The last decade of Mr. Martsolf’s career is nothing short of a testament to his versatility as an actor, successfully completing over 1500 theatrical performances and 2000+ television episodes.

These profound numbers stem from his 4 year comic portrayal of the Pharaoh in Andrew Lloyd Webber's Joseph & the Amazing Technicolor Dreamcoat, in which he consistently drew in acclaimed reviews from the harshest of nationwide critics, calling him a "mix of Elvis and Stallone-a blend of charisma, muscular framework, and talent to be reckoned with." Mr. Martsolf is most widely recognized for his six year popular portrayal of Ethan Winthrop on NBC’s Passions, where in which he claimed numerous accolades from peers and fans alike.

He additionally drew in the largest numbers in Directv’s original programming history while hosting "Passions Live", the first live call in show for any daytime genre. His comedic adeptness was critically commended in 2007 for his portrayal of L'il Abner alongside Fred Willard for LA's Reprise series under the artistic direction of Jason Alexander.

He currently portrays the role of Brady Black on NBC's historic sudser “Days of our Lives.” Mr. Martsolf is the proud father of twin sons Chase and Mason, and husband to Lisa Martsolf.
